// REINDEX_BATCH_CAP limits docs per shard pass in the Tallowfield
// nightly search reindex. Raising it starves the ingest queue;
// lowering it overruns the maintenance window. 5000 is the tested
// sweet spot. Change only with a soak run. Verified against the
// build noted below.

session token of bawif-hahog = htk6_ac5981

## Storage Room B-07 — Spare Hardware

B-07 (basement, past the loading bay) holds spare laptops, monitors, and cabling for the Ardwell site. Facilities desk handles all check-outs; log items on the clipboard inside. No unescorted contractor access. Door auto-locks — don't prop it. Restock requests go through the facilities queue. Keypad code is below.

staff pass of kawip-hawef = bdg-QLP-2

If Deploybot stops posting deploy status to the release channel, first check the Pipewatch dashboard for stalled webhooks. Restarting the bot via the Ops console resolves most stuck states within two minutes. If status messages remain absent after a restart, or if deploys are proceeding without visibility, treat it as a release-blocking incident. Page the Tooling on-call through the standard rotation. If the rotation does not acknowledge within fifteen minutes, escalate directly to the Deploybot maintainers at the address below.

alerts address for bawif-hahig: norwyn_gorys_lamath@olvarqlabs.test

## v2.8.1 — Key Rotation

FeedCheckly has rotated the signing key used to verify plugin manifests for the podcast feed validator. Plugins signed with the old key will continue to validate until the end of next month, after which they will be rejected at load time. Plugin authors should re-sign their manifests using the updated toolchain in validator-cli 2.8 or later. No API changes accompany this release. The new public signing key is shown below.

signing key of kahog-kadup = bky13_6wLyxnPsJob4P

Hi all — cut-over done. The nightly reindex for Searchwick now runs off the new Brindle cluster; old cron jobs are disabled, not deleted, in case we need to roll back. Index times dropped from 4h to 90 minutes. For whoever inherits this, the job now runs with these settings.

deployment values, yadug-bawif:
[framir]
team = pelox
access_code = ac_a38ab2
owner = tamion.julael
host = framir.tolvaqlabs.test
port = 11211
peer = tammir.zemvargrid.local
salt = 2215ef03
pin = 1541